Shot Blasting System Maintenance: Optimal Practices and Key Tips
Regular upkeep of your shot peening machine is vital for consistent performance and extended equipment longevity . A preventative maintenance schedule can substantially reduce stoppages and expensive repairs. Here’s a overview at important practices:
- Examine frequently for issues to lines , nozzles , and bowl .
- Remove loose grit from the machine – this minimizes blockages and ensures consistent coverage.
- Grease moving parts according to the maker’s instructions.
- Track compressed air and media flow for proper operation.
- Change worn parts quickly to prevent further harm .
- Book periodic certified evaluations to identify potential problems early.
Disregarding these easy procedures can lead to lower effectiveness , higher operating costs , and accelerated equipment failure .
